The carriage traveled steadily, turning four to five streets and passing through a square with a pond. Soon, it stopped on a relatively quiet street.
Lu Sheng paid the fare and alighted. He lifted his head to look at a large stone signboard at the corner of the street.
It was a large, greyish-white stone the shape of a finger. Three words were clearly written in cinnabar: Fine Treasures Hall.
"Old Master Lu! Aiyo, why didn't you send someone to inform us that you were coming? We could have set up a good scene to welcome you! "The shopkeeper hurriedly ran out in fright at the sight of Lu Sheng, smiling apologetically.
Anyone with some knowledge in Mountain-Edge City knew of External Head Lu's reputation. His battle record of killing Sect Master Gongsun had instantly established an image of a ferocious and ferocious expert in everyone's hearts.
"Please come in! Please come in! " The shopkeeper was a rotund man. His beady eyes were wide open, wiping his sweat with his sleeves as he led Lu Sheng inside.
"Where's the stuff?" Lu Sheng couldn't be bothered to look at the exterior of the shop. He was in a hurry. While the Zhen Family and the ghosts were in full swing, he had to make the best use of his time to improve himself and prepare himself.
"Here, here, it's all here!" The shopkeeper hurriedly said. After leading Lu Sheng into the shop, they quickly passed through the back hall and came to the two large chests in the corner.
"The real ones have just been unearthed. They haven't even had time to wash off the muddy smell. Please bear with us," the shopkeeper smiled apologetically.
"You guys, open the lids!"
He hurriedly ordered the two shop assistants to lift the lids.
Two muscular shop assistants came forward. Each opened the locks of the two chests and quickly flipped the lids open.
"Clang."
The lids slammed against the wall behind with a dull thud. Revealing the messy assortment of items inside.
"It's fine. What I want is freshness," Lu Sheng was unconcerned. He squatted down in front of one of the chests and casually picked up a bronze sword.
No Yin Qi.
He switched to another bronze candlestick.
No Yin Qi either.
A third, a short iron sword.
Still nothing.
"I'll take a look at them one by one. You guys don't have to worry about them. Go do your own things," Lu Sheng said casually.
How could the shopkeeper dare to leave? To begin with, he wasn't the owner of this shop, but the head shopkeeper of the entire Fine Treasures Hall. But when he heard the order from above that Crimson Whale Sect's External Head Lu was actually coming to his branch to pick out items, he was so frightened that he hurriedly ran out of his own mansion to personally receive Lu Sheng.
He quietly waved his hand to signal the other two to leave, while he himself took a few steps back. He stayed here alone and waited for further instructions.
Lu Sheng took out the items one by one and threw them aside. Soon, he had finished looking through the dozens of items in the first box. None of them had Yin Qi.
He was not surprised. Yin Qi could be stored in items, but it dissipated very quickly. Items that did not dissipate Yin Qi were extremely rare.
Lu Sheng walked to the second box, squatted down, and continued to look through it.
One by one, the items were taken out and thrown to the side. Halfway through, Lu Sheng's movements suddenly paused. His hand stopped, and he held a gold-threaded red jade bracelet in his hand. Ignoring the blackish-yellow mud on it, he picked it up and examined it closely.
Wisps of cold Yin Qi flowed continuously from the jade bracelet into Lu Sheng's arm.
He studied the bracelet carefully. There was a line of tiny words on it.
'Where are the Nine Phoenixes of Clear Stream?'
"Where did this bracelet come from?" he asked the shopkeeper.
"Old Master, these items were collected from those individual sellers. We're not sure which ones they came from," the shopkeeper said awkwardly.
"Alright, it's fine," Lu Sheng put the jade bracelet aside and continued looking through the rest of the items.
This time, he wasn't as lucky as before. None of the remaining items contained Yin Qi.
Lu Sheng stood up with the gold-threaded jade bracelet in his hand.
"I'll take this bracelet. Name a price. "
The shopkeeper took the bracelet and looked at it.
"Since Old Master Lu is doing me the honor, I'll take the cost price of twenty taels."
Lu Sheng fished out two silver notes and handed over twenty taels. He stood up and left the inner hall with the jade bracelet in hand.
"Remember to inform me if there's any new stock in the future."
He reminded the shopkeeper before he left.
"Don't worry. Definitely, definitely!" the shopkeeper replied with a forced smile.
With the jade bracelet in hand, Lu Sheng hailed a horse carriage and went straight back to the greenhouse.
Along the way, the jade bracelet continued to gush out Yin Qi into his body.
Back in the greenhouse, he went to his room to recuperate. He ordered everyone not to disturb him and to close the door.
As soon as Lu Sheng sat down, he washed the jade bracelet with the tea in the teapot and wiped it dry with a handkerchief. The entire jade bracelet instantly became extraordinarily smooth and clean.
Under the light, the red jade glowed faintly with the color of rippling blood.
By now, the Yin Qi in the jade bracelet was almost completely absorbed.
"Deep Blue!"
The Modifier flashed before Lu Sheng's eyes.
He focused his attention on the back of the martial arts panel. Thankfully, most martial arts had buttons behind them except for Yin-Yang Jade Crane Skill.
He looked at Ultimate Crimson Mantra again. There was a button behind Ultimate Crimson Mantra Level Six as well. Clearly, the Yin Qi absorbed this time was enough to upgrade it by one level.
'Extrapolate martial arts?' the Modifier asked again.
'Yes.' Lu Sheng thought for a moment and decided to go with his previous choice.
The dialog box disappeared. He quickly looked at Ultimate Crimson Mantra. The button behind it was still there.
'To counter the poison of Bind, the only thing I can rely on is Yang inner force. Ultimate Crimson Mantra is the main thing I must rely on first to upgrade. It's also the main thing I can rely on to injure ghosts.'
After confirming his choice, Lu Sheng focused his attention and pressed the button behind Ultimate Crimson Mantra.
"Swish."
As the button was pressed, the frame blurred and quickly became clear again. The words from before had completely changed into a new state.
'Ultimate Crimson Mantra: Level Seven. Special Effect: Blood Web. Enhanced Fire Poison, Sixfold Tremor, Enhanced Ignition. '
'Blood Web … there's one after all,' Lu Sheng's heart leaped with joy.
According to the manual, when Ultimate Crimson Mantra reached the pinnacle, the inner Qi in the body would circulate and the firepower would reach its limit. It would then naturally produce a network of inner Qi that covered the entire body.
This was the blood web mentioned in the manual.
But as for how powerful the blood web was, Lu Sheng had no idea. Although he could feel the inner force in his body rapidly expanding and strengthening, he could not feel any other minute changes.
He took out the white box and opened it again. He took out a porcelain bottle from within and removed the stopper. Gently, he poured a drop of black liquid onto his palm.
"Hiss …"
A puff of white smoke rose, and a rancid stench filled the air.
Lu Sheng could clearly see that drop of black liquid flowing and trembling in his palm. It was as if it had been dropped onto a boiling hot pot. It rapidly shrunk, evaporated, and then disappeared completely.
'One drop is already very easy. It only took three breaths to cancel it out. ' Lu Sheng felt the consumption of inner Qi. 'The quality of Ultimate Crimson Qi has also increased significantly. I only used twenty percent of my inner Qi to achieve the same effect as before. It doesn't seem like a huge increase, but in actual fact, my inner force has increased by at least four times! As expected of the pinnacle realm of Ultimate Crimson Mantra. '
'Let's try the blood web again,' Lu Sheng stood up and circulated the inner force in his body.
Instantly, he felt a layer of invisible inner Qi web appear on his skin, protecting every part of his body.
'Interesting,' he raised his index finger and slowly probed towards the edge of the table.
When it was a knuckle away from the table, Lu Sheng clearly felt something blocking his fingertip, preventing it from moving any further.
Moreover, this thing was like a ball of cotton, extremely elastic. He could squeeze it forward a few times, but it was unable to touch the table.
"Hiss …"
Suddenly, the edge of the wooden table burst into flames. The bright flames spread rapidly along the tablecloth towards the entire table.
'Although it has a certain defensive effect and has fire poison properties, the temperature is too low and slow. Even the tablecloth has to be touched for a few breaths before it can ignite …' Lu Sheng grabbed the teapot and splashed it on the table, instantly extinguishing the flames.
'Against ordinary people and ordinary experts, this blood web is indeed very useful. As long as the body wears a layer of leather armor, with this layer of blood web as a shield, even the strongest attack can be weakened by a few times. But against ghosts, this is not enough. I must continue to strengthen it! '
'Right, Changing the Heavens in Seven Days Saber Technique also emits net-like Qi. Perhaps there will be additional effects?' Lu Sheng quickly flipped through the secret manual of Ultimate Crimson Mantra.
Unfortunately, the Changing the Heavens in Seven Days Saber Technique mentioned above was only a simplified version that mimicked the special effects of Level Seven Ultimate Crimson Mantra.
Now that he had the strength of Level Seven, this Changing the Heavens in Seven Days Saber Technique was obviously of little value.
'It just so happens that I have an A-grade, third-class contribution. I can go to the sect to pick a martial art that I like. With A-grade contribution, I should be able to choose the best inner force mantra manuals, right? 'Lu Sheng felt rather helpless.
Even if he cultivated Ultimate Crimson Mantra to its peak, reaching the level of the previous Crimson Sun Sect Master, according to the Bind poison conversion in the porcelain bottle, he would only be able to resist half of the poison of Bind.
Lu Sheng guessed that the degree of resistance to the poison was directly proportional to the defensive strength of Bind.
If that was the case, even if he were to unleash his full strength, he would still need to double his current strength to break through the defensive barrier of Bind.
"External Head! Sect Master has ordered for all senior executives to gather at the Crimson Whale! "
Jade Lotus's voice suddenly sounded from outside the door.
"All senior executives?" Lu Sheng narrowed his eyes. "Did he say what's going on?"
"No." Jade Lotus was a little gloomy. After all, he was not considered a senior executive. His skills were sufficient, but his strength was still lacking. He still needed more training. Otherwise, he would have known the truth by now.
"Got it. I'll be right out. It's just as well that I need to make a trip to headquarters. "
Lu Sheng kept the porcelain bottle and placed it back in the box under his bed. Then, he tidied up his clothes and opened the door.
"The horse is ready. External Head, you'd better be thrifty. A good horse is worth a fortune. Nobody can stand such wastage if they just throw it away," Jade Lotus exasperatedly reminded Lu Sheng. The horse that Lu Sheng had ridden previously had disappeared to god knows where. Now, the Mountain-Edge City branch didn't even have a single good horse.
"Got it," Lu Sheng laughed in spite of himself. Once out of the house, a sect member immediately led a batch of red horses to him.
"Also, we can bring Lu Chenxin's corpse back tonight. Is it time?" he asked suddenly.
"It's time." Jade Lotus nodded. For some reason, the way he looked at Lu Sheng now gave him the feeling that he was a completely different person than before.
If one were to describe him as a ferocious beast previously, then right now, the External Head's aura was thicker and more profound. He gave off a sense of stability and serenity, like a mountain.
"Then bring him here first. I'll bring him back personally," Lu Sheng instructed. No matter what, he had to give his family an explanation.
